Down Payment Assistance Programs
Down payment assistance programs are often provided by state and local governments to help individuals overcome financial barriers and achieve homeownership. These programs offer government grants or mortgage insurance to qualified homebuyers, reducing the burden of upfront costs. By providing financial support, these programs aim to make homeownership more accessible for individuals who may not have sufficient savings for a down payment.

Tax Credits and Incentives
One aspect to consider when exploring tax credits and incentives is the potential financial benefits available to home buyers. These benefits include:
1. Mortgage interest deductions: By deducting mortgage interest paid from your taxable income, you can significantly reduce your overall tax burden.
2. Energy efficient home incentives: Some states offer tax credits or rebates for purchasing energy-efficient homes or making energy-saving improvements, providing both financial savings and environmental benefits.
